Simple Weather MCP Server example from Quickstart
An example explained MCP Quickstart: https://modelcontextprotocol.io/quickstart
How to build
npm install
npm run build
Claude for Desktop configuration
cursor ~/Library/Application\ Support/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json
{
"mcpServers": {
"weather": {
"command": "node",
"args": [
"/ABSOLUTE/PATH/TO/PARENT/FOLDER/weather/build/index.js"
]
}
}
}
